Abstract: In this article we want to introduce first the Gabor wavelet network as a model
based approach for an effective and efficient object representation. The Gabor
wavelet network has several advantages such as invariance to some degree
with respect to translation, rotation and dilation. Furthermore, the use
of Gabor filters ensured that geometrical and textural object features are encoded.
The feasibility of the Gabor filters as a model for local object features
ensures a considerable data... (Update)
